13 November 2020, Babylon NY – A 30-sec TV spot for Family Service League of Long Island, which recently had a multi-week run on News 12 Long Island, features narration by local voice over talent Rob Carbone.

The project, pulled together by Adam Holtzer of Connections4Hire, Inc, was designed to bring greater awareness of this amazing charitable organization throughout the Nassau and Suffolk communities. The spot, produced by Tommy Nickel, focuses on the many fine outreach efforts performed by FSL to the surrounding community. Among these are assistance with addiction, a topic that has sadly been a constant in the Long Island headlines due to the ongoing opioid crisis that has gripped the community.
